Ingredients and Necessary Utensils
To create these delightful Comforting Chicken Mashed Potato Bowls for Busy Nights, you will need the following ingredients:
- 2 cups cooked chicken, shredded
- 4 cups mashed potatoes (homemade or store-bought)
- 1 cup frozen mixed vegetables (peas, carrots, corn)
- 1 cup chicken broth
- 1 cup shredded cheddar cheese
- 1/2 cup milk
- 1/4 cup butter
- Salt and pepper to taste
- Fresh parsley for garnish (optional)
In addition to the ingredients, you’ll need the following utensils for successful preparation:
- Large saucepan for heating the chicken and vegetables
- Mixing bowl for preparing mashed potatoes (if making homemade)
- Potato masher or electric mixer (if making homemade mashed potatoes)
- Serving bowls for assembling the meal
- Wooden spoon or spatula for stirring
Detailed Recipe Steps
Now that you have your ingredients and utensils ready, let’s dive into the step-by-step process of making these delicious Comforting Chicken Mashed Potato Bowls for Busy Nights.
- Prepare Mashed Potatoes: If you are making homemade mashed potatoes, start by peeling and chopping your potatoes. Boil them in salted water until tender (about 15-20 minutes). Once cooked, drain them and mash with milk, butter, salt, and pepper until smooth. If you’re using store-bought mashed potatoes, simply heat them according to the package instructions.
- Heat Chicken and Vegetables: In a large saucepan, combine your shredded chicken and frozen mixed vegetables. Pour in the chicken broth, and heat over medium heat for about 5-7 minutes, stirring occasionally until everything is warmed through.
- Add Cheese: Once your chicken and vegetables are heated, stir in the shredded cheddar cheese. Keep stirring until the cheese melts and is well incorporated into the mixture. This will add a creamy texture and rich flavor to your bowl.
- Assemble the Bowls: In each serving bowl, place a generous scoop of your creamy mashed potatoes at the bottom. Top it off with the cheesy chicken and vegetable mixture, ensuring each bowl is filled generously.
- Garnish and Serve: For an extra touch, drizzle some additional chicken broth over the top of each bowl if desired. Sprinkle fresh parsley for a pop of color and serve warm. Enjoy your comforting meal!
FAQs
Can I use leftover chicken for this recipe?
Absolutely! Using leftover chicken is a great way to save time and reduce waste. Just shred the chicken and follow the recipe as directed.
What type of cheese works best for this dish?
While I recommend cheddar cheese for its flavor and melting qualities, you can also experiment with mozzarella, Monterey Jack, or even a blend of cheeses to suit your taste.
Can I make this dish vegetarian?
Yes! You can easily make this dish vegetarian by substituting the chicken with plant-based proteins, such as tofu or chickpeas, and using vegetable broth instead of chicken broth.
How can I make the mashed potatoes healthier?
To make the mashed potatoes healthier, consider using low-fat milk, Greek yogurt, or even cauliflower for a lighter version. You can also add herbs for extra flavor without added calories.
Can I prepare this dish ahead of time?
Yes! You can prepare the chicken and vegetables ahead of time and store them in the fridge. Just reheat before serving, then assemble your bowls with freshly made mashed potatoes.
